CI note: keyspin-rotate job on Varnholt CI failed twice on stage gate after the vault sidecar upgrade. Root cause: rotation utility cached stale lease IDs and retried against revoked paths. Fix shipped in keyspin 0.9.4; lease cache now invalidated on 403. No secrets exposed; audit log confirms rotation completed on third run. Verify against the pipeline trace below.

trace token, kahog-tajeg: htk6_97d963

First, confirm whether the ingestion pipeline or only the viewer UI is affected; a viewer-only outage does not block a release, whereas ingestion gaps do. Second, page the Ledger Integrity rotation and record the incident in the Bellhaven tracker with severity and affected window. Third, freeze any pending deploys touching the audit schema. If the rotation does not acknowledge within fifteen minutes, escalate directly by writing to the address below.

pager mailbox: belion.norael.ralvan@urlaqnet.local

## Data Stores — Date Localization Notes

Heads up for review: the Lanternly app stores all timestamps as UTC epoch in the Corvid cluster, and localization happens purely at render time via the locale table. No formatted dates ever hit disk, so injection surface there is nil. The locale table itself is tiny and read-only in prod. To inspect it yourself, point your client at the read replica using the connection string below.

replica DSN, kajep-yahag: mssql://praok_svc:iF@db-8d68.plorvaio.local:5432/eliion

## Waveform Preview Service — Runbook

Plugin authors: preview strips are rendered by the internal SoundSketch service. Do not render waveforms client-side; request them.

Steps:
1. POST audio reference to the render endpoint.
2. Poll status until `done`.
3. Fetch the PNG strip; cache for 24h.

Limits: 10 req/s per plugin, files under 200 MB. Exceeding limits returns 429; back off exponentially.

All requests require the SoundSketch service key in the auth header. The current key is below.

service key, kawip-kahop: kto4_QQzB